Breast Cancer SOAP note Name Sharon Broom Date: January/17/2020. Age: 45 years old Gender: Female Time:12:45 SUBJECTIVE: Chief Complaint: “I have a sore lump on the left breast." History of Present Illness: Sharon is a 45-year-old female with complaints of a painful lump on her left breast for a month. The patient indicates that she feels unbalanced lumps on her left breast that are painful on the outer and upper corners. The patient observed the areas of the left outer breast worsening in terms of size and pain in the past week. She has experienced the pain of level four out of ten. Her mother was detected to have breast cancer prior to the age of 50. She has had a history of hysterectomy because of irregular periods, menorrhagia. The patient refutes swelling, increased warmth, and redness of the left breast. She repudiates nipple discharge swollen glands, chills, and fever.
